Ashtead to Coatbridge Sunnyside by train

A train trip from Ashtead to Coatbridge Sunnyside takes about 7hrs 54 mins on average, covering roughly 349 miles (562 kilometres). With around 14 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£58.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ashtead to Coatbridge Sunnyside start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ashtead to Coatbridge Sunnyside start from £131.80 one way, or £188.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ashtead to Coatbridge Sunnyside are available for £204.20 one way, or £408.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Ashtead Station

Ashtead Station, managed by Southern, offers a variety of amenities to cater to travelers' diverse needs. The ticket office operates from early morning to late at night, ensuring you can purchase tickets and seek assistance throughout much of the day. Ticket machines, accessible to all, are fitted to acc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, although you might want to verify accessibility across the station first.

Passenger support is a priority with help points and staff available most of the day. While luggage storage options are not available, there's plenty of seating, and for those keen on staying connected, pay phones are provided.

Accessible Travel at Ashtead

At Ashtead Station, accessibility is thoughtfully integrated. While the station offers partial step-free access through level crossings, it’s advisable to pre-book assistance or reach out for help upon your arrival. The station staff are trained and willing to assist, including using ramps for boarding trains. Despite the absence of accessible toilets, there are accessible ticket machines and a designated drop-off and pick-up point for travelers with impaired mobility.

On Wheels or On Foot: Easy Access

However you choose to journey, Ashtead caters with ample car parking operated by APCOA Parking UK, open 24 hours, offering 240 spaces including 12 dedicated to accessible parking. Cyclists are also accommodated with storage stands located safely within the station’s car park.

Facilities and Amenities at Coatbridge Sunnyside

At Coatbridge Sunnyside, passengers are greeted with a user-friendly environment. The station is equipped with a ticket office that is open Monday through Saturday from 05:46 to 19:34 and offers ticket machines for convenience. For those who prefer to plan ahead, tickets purchased online can be collected from the available machines. Accessibility is a priority here with step-free access to platform 1 and a helpful assistance program available for those requiring extra support.

Customer service is always at the forefront. Should you need assistance, staff help is available during office hours, and customer help points are strategically located around the station. CCTV surveillance ensures security around the clock. However, it's worth noting that there aren't any luggage storage facilities, so plan accordingly if you have heavy baggage in tow.
